COLINES, SIMON DE, printer. Bound volume containing 4 works on Roman history. 8vo, 169x100 mm, modern reversed leather with vellum lettering piece, preserving early endpapers with manuscript list of Roman and Holy Roman emperors; apart from early underscoring and marginalia, contents generally clean except as noted below. Modern stamp of the Centre Culturel des Prémontrés on titles and elsewhere in volume; ownership inscription of the Benedictine Abbey of St. Leopold, Nancy, dated 1739 on first title. Renouard (Colines), pages 308, 182, 184-85, and 310-11. Paris, 1531-39

Additional Details

Eutropius. De gestis Romanorum libri decem. 68 leaves. 1539 Paulus Diaconus. De gestis Romanorum libri octo ad Eutropii historiam additi. 48 leaves. 1531 Sextus Aurelius Victor. Historia de vita et moribus imperatorum Romanorum. 28 leaves. Title toned, with owner's inscription dated 1569. 1531 Herodianus. Libri octo. Latin translation by Angelo Poliziano. [16], 102, [2] leaves, including 2 blanks at end. Clean tear in f1. 1539.
